作者 朱兆平

bug-fix:

1. 权限管理界面优化
2. 转关运抵界面错误提示参数修复
3. 取消websocket的初始化
1 1
2 var websock = null; 2 var websock = null;
3 var global_callback = null; 3 var global_callback = null;
4 -var serverPort = '10002'; //webSocket连接端口 4 +var serverPort = '9088'; //webSocket连接端口
5 5
6 6
7 function getWebIP(){ 7 function getWebIP(){
@@ -11,7 +11,7 @@ function getWebIP(){ @@ -11,7 +11,7 @@ function getWebIP(){
11 11
12 function initWebSocket(){ //初始化weosocket 12 function initWebSocket(){ //初始化weosocket
13 //ws地址 13 //ws地址
14 - var wsuri = "ws://" +getWebIP()+ ":" + serverPort+"/websocket"; 14 + var wsuri = "wss://" +getWebIP()+ ":" + serverPort+"/websocket";
15 websock = new WebSocket(wsuri); 15 websock = new WebSocket(wsuri);
16 websock.onmessage = function(e){ 16 websock.onmessage = function(e){
17 websocketonmessage(e); 17 websocketonmessage(e);
@@ -69,7 +69,7 @@ function websocketOpen(e){ @@ -69,7 +69,7 @@ function websocketOpen(e){
69 console.log("连接成功"); 69 console.log("连接成功");
70 } 70 }
71 71
72 -initWebSocket(); 72 +// initWebSocket();
73 73
74 export{sendSock} 74 export{sendSock}
75 75
@@ -12,7 +12,7 @@ import rout from './routes' @@ -12,7 +12,7 @@ import rout from './routes'
12 import i18n from './lang' 12 import i18n from './lang'
13 import 'font-awesome/css/font-awesome.min.css' 13 import 'font-awesome/css/font-awesome.min.css'
14 import drag from './drag' 14 import drag from './drag'
15 -import * as socketApi from './api/socket' 15 +// import * as socketApi from './api/socket'
16 import '@/styles/index.scss' 16 import '@/styles/index.scss'
17 import sys_init from '@/common/init/sys_init' 17 import sys_init from '@/common/init/sys_init'
18 import Print from 'vue-print-nb' 18 import Print from 'vue-print-nb'
@@ -45,11 +45,13 @@ @@ -45,11 +45,13 @@
45 </el-table-column> 45 </el-table-column>
46 <el-table-column prop="permissionOrder" label="排序" width="100" sortable> 46 <el-table-column prop="permissionOrder" label="排序" width="100" sortable>
47 </el-table-column> 47 </el-table-column>
48 - <el-table-column label="操作" align="center" width="230" fixed="right"> 48 + <el-table-column label="操作" align="center" width="250" fixed="right">
49 <template slot-scope="scope"> 49 <template slot-scope="scope">
  50 + <el-row>
50 <el-button type="success" @click="handleEdit(scope.$index, scope.row)">编辑</el-button> 51 <el-button type="success" @click="handleEdit(scope.$index, scope.row)">编辑</el-button>
51 <el-button type="warning" @click="handleEdit(scope.$index, scope.row)">白名单</el-button> 52 <el-button type="warning" @click="handleEdit(scope.$index, scope.row)">白名单</el-button>
52 <el-button type="danger" @click="handleDel(scope.$index, scope.row)">删除</el-button> 53 <el-button type="danger" @click="handleDel(scope.$index, scope.row)">删除</el-button>
  54 + </el-row>
53 </template> 55 </template>
54 </el-table-column> 56 </el-table-column>
55 </el-table> 57 </el-table>
@@ -876,7 +876,7 @@ @@ -876,7 +876,7 @@
876 // 刷新列表 876 // 刷新列表
877 this.trnList() 877 this.trnList()
878 }).catch(error => { 878 }).catch(error => {
879 - this.$message.error(res.msg) 879 + this.$message.error(error.msg)
880 }) 880 })
881 }).catch(() => { 881 }).catch(() => {
882 }) 882 })